You are in Security screening, which is not unusual for people with military service, and especially if you are from Israel.

Every time you submit new documents, those documents will be reviewed by an officer and you will see those notes, even when your eligibility has been passed. It will take time, and to know at what stage of the SS process you are, i.e. whether CSIS and CBSA have concluded their involvement in your case, you will need to get the CBSA and CSIS notes.

In the CBSA notes there there should be 4 security related activities, which will indicate how far you file has gone in terms of SS.

The length of SS is never reasonable. However, for SS CSIS and CBSA are involved. There are other agencies too, bit these two are the most prominent. First the CSIS conducts its search and then submits its report to CBSA, which then does it own BGC and submits the final report to IRCC.

For some applicants SS has taken 2 or more years.

The security process is a closely guarded secret, so the thumb ruse is that if 3 months have elapsed after your eligibility was passed, then you are in enhanced security screening. One way to know if you are nearing the end is 4 SS related activities in your GCMS notes. Most applicants have 4 SS activities who have gone through the security and their application is approved. If you have 3, then you are very close to the finish.
